Introduction
The digital era is upon us, and with it comes unprecedented opportunities to transform skills into tangible wealth. For developers, programmers, and tech enthusiasts, the ability to write and understand code is no longer just a profession it’s a gateway to financial independence. The phrase "turning code into currency" isn't just a catchy slogan; it's a reality shaped by innovation, technology, and creativity. This blog explores how coding skills can be leveraged to generate income, sustain careers, and even build empires.
The Growing Demand for Coders
The global demand for coding expertise has skyrocketed. Reports indicate that the software development industry is projected to grow by nearly 22% between now and 2030. Every industry, from healthcare to entertainment, relies on software solutions to streamline operations and deliver value to customers. In 2023 alone, companies spent over $500 billion on software development, with a significant portion allocated to freelancers, agencies, and startups.
This surge is fueled by the digital transformation of businesses worldwide. Companies need web applications, mobile apps, e-commerce platforms, and custom tools to stay competitive. As a result, the skills gap in the tech workforce has widened. Coders who can meet these demands are not just filling roles; they’re creating wealth.
Monetizing Your Coding Skills
Freelancing in the Gig Economy
Freelance platforms such as Upwork, Toptal, and Fiverr have become lucrative marketplaces for coders. Offering services as a freelance developer allows you to work with diverse clients and projects. With rates ranging from $25 to $150 per hour, experienced coders can earn a substantial income while enjoying the flexibility of remote work.
A case study highlights how a self-taught Python developer earned over $200,000 within three years by focusing on data analysis projects. By consistently delivering quality work and building a strong portfolio, this developer turned part-time gigs into a thriving full-time career.
Building SaaS Products
Creating Software-as-a-Service (SaaS) products is another profitable avenue. Developers can identify niche problems, build solutions, and sell subscription-based access to their software. Successful examples include Trello, Slack, and Canva, all of which started as small-scale solutions.
Consider the story of a developer who created a time-tracking tool for freelancers. Starting with just $5,000 in savings, this individual built and marketed the tool, which now generates over $50,000 in monthly recurring revenue. SaaS products offer scalability and the potential for passive income.
Selling Courses and Tutorials
Online education is booming, with platforms like Udemy, Coursera, and YouTube providing opportunities to teach coding. Experienced developers can monetize their knowledge by creating courses, tutorials, or even eBooks. A popular JavaScript instructor reportedly earned $1 million in two years by teaching coding through online platforms.
The key to success lies in creating content that addresses real-world problems. Aspiring coders seek practical guidance, and those who deliver value through step-by-step tutorials or unique insights can build a loyal audience.
Open Source Contributions and Sponsorships
Open-source contributions are not just a way to give back to the community. They can also lead to sponsorships or job offers. Platforms like GitHub now allow developers to receive sponsorships for their contributions. Companies often hire contributors who demonstrate expertise in specific frameworks or libraries, turning voluntary work into lucrative opportunities.
Creating and Selling Digital Products
Templates, plugins, and themes for platforms like WordPress, Shopify, and Webflow are in high demand. Developers can create and sell these digital products on marketplaces such as ThemeForest or their websites. A designer-developer duo reportedly made $500,000 in a year by selling premium WordPress themes tailored to small businesses.
Case Studies: Success Stories from the Field
The App That Changed a Career
A junior developer with minimal experience built a budgeting app during weekends. Using a simple design and basic features, the app addressed a specific audience young professionals struggling with finances. After launching on the App Store, the app gained traction and generated $10,000 in revenue within six months. The success attracted a larger tech company, which acquired the app for $100,000, transforming the developer’s career.
Turning Open Source into a Business
Another developer, frustrated by the lack of documentation tools for APIs, created an open-source solution. The project gained popularity, and companies began sponsoring the developer. Recognizing the demand, the individual launched a premium version of the tool with advanced features. Within two years, the tool generated over $1 million in revenue.
The Rise of Indie Game Developers
Indie game development is another example of coding turned into currency. Developers who create engaging games can monetize through sales, in-game purchases, and ads. Stardew Valley, a farming simulation game developed by a solo coder, earned over $30 million within its first few years of release. Platforms like Steam and Epic Games provide an ecosystem for indie developers to showcase their creations.
Overcoming Challenges in the Journey
While the opportunities are vast, the journey to monetizing coding skills isn’t without hurdles. Understanding market needs, mastering marketing, and managing finances are critical. Many developers fail not due to lack of talent but because they overlook these aspects.
Consistency is key. The Python developer mentioned earlier emphasized the importance of learning from every project, even when facing difficult clients. Building a portfolio and reputation takes time, but persistence pays off.
SEO Tips for Coders Marketing Their Products
If you’re venturing into SaaS, digital products, or courses, mastering SEO can amplify your reach. Here are practical strategies:
Focus on long-tail keywords that reflect user intent. Instead of targeting "best coding course," try "learn Python for data analysis."
Optimize your website speed and usability. Coders have the advantage of understanding technical SEO.
Create valuable, evergreen content like blogs or tutorials that address common challenges.
Engage with communities on Reddit, Stack Overflow, or GitHub to build credibility and drive organic traffic.
Leverage video content for tutorials or product demos to enhance visibility.
The Future of Coding as Currency
As technology evolves, the ways to monetize coding skills will continue to expand. Artificial intelligence, blockchain, and augmented reality present new frontiers. Developers who stay ahead of trends and continually update their skills will find themselves in high demand.
The rise of low-code and no-code platforms may seem like a threat, but they’re more of an opportunity. These platforms often require customization, integration, and advanced features, creating new roles for skilled developers.
FAQs
How much can a beginner coder earn?
Beginners can earn anywhere from $20 to $50 per hour freelancing, depending on their skill set and niche. As experience grows, so do the rates.
What programming languages are most profitable?
Languages like Python, JavaScript, and C++ are in high demand due to their versatility and applications in web development, AI, and gaming.
Do I need formal education to monetize coding?
Not necessarily. Many successful coders are self-taught. Practical experience, a strong portfolio, and the ability to solve problems matter more than degrees.
What’s the best way to start freelancing?
Start by creating a profile on platforms like Upwork or Fiverr. Build a small portfolio with personal projects, and bid on smaller tasks to gain reviews and credibility.
Can I combine coding with other skills to earn more?
Absolutely. Combining coding with skills like digital marketing, graphic design, or data analysis can open up more opportunities and increase earning potential.
Conclusion
Turning code into currency is no longer a distant dream but a realistic goal. The path is challenging but rewarding for those who embrace learning, adaptability, and perseverance. Whether freelancing, building products, or teaching others, coding skills hold the potential to generate wealth and create lasting impact. The digital alchemy is real; all it takes is the courage to start.
0 Comments